Fiji Netball team captain to the Pacific Cup Series in the Cook Islands, Ana Erenavula is confident the team will deliver exceptional results at the games.

Erenavula said the team has been training very hard in the past few months and despite knowing earlier that they had no funds to take the team across, the girls still trained hard.    

However, Erenavula added the girls know that they will have to lift their standard at the Pacific Cup Series to secure a spot at the 2011 World Championships.

Former national captain, Australia based Mere Rabuka arrived into the country last week, something Erenavula said lifted the morale of the team, a timely arrival that coincided with the AFriends of Fiji@ donation of over $30,000 for their airfares to the Cook Islands.

The Fiji Netball team will be meeting up with teams from Samoa, the Cook Islands and Australia at the championship.
